Café Thirty-A raises $50,000 for Caring and Sharing of South Walton

Niceville.comJanuary 16, 20233 Mins Read
Cafe Thirty-A charity check presentation 2022
(From L to R) Jackie Maliszewski, office manager of Café Thirty-A, Harriet Crommelin, owner of Café Thirty-A, and Carly Barnes, executive director of Caring & Sharing of South Walton. (Contributed)

WALTON COUNTY, Fla. – Café Thirty-A has presented Caring and Sharing of South Walton with a $50,000 check, the proceeds from the popular Seagrove Beach restaurant’s annual Christmas event.

Café Thirty-A ‘s Annual Christmas Charity Ball held on December 2, raised a record-breaking $50,000 for Caring and Sharing of South Walton, an organization that provides food and financial assistance to area families and individuals in need.

“It is an honor to host this event for Caring and Sharing of South Walton each year,” said Harriet Crommelin, owner of Café Thirty-A.

“This year was extra special because we raised a record amount of $50,000! We love what this organization represents and all they do for our community.”

The money was raised through ticket sales, sponsorship, donations, and funds raised from a silent auction. The funds raised by the event will be used to provide local families with access to food, financial assistance, case management, and connection to other resources.

“We are blown away by the community’s support of this event, and we are so very grateful for the continued support of Cafe Thirty-A,” said Carly Barnes, executive director of Caring and Sharing of South Walton.

“These funds will help us keep up with increased demands for our services and allow us to support our neighbors in need in so many ways.”

The sold-out event welcomed over 250 guests to the festively decorated restaurant, where they were greeted with complimentary valet sponsored by Corcoran Reverie and a glass of champagne courtesy of Foundation Title and Escrow.

Inside, eventgoers enjoyed heavy hors d’oeuvres, a gourmet dinner buffet, music by DJ Wub Control, sponsored by Centennial Bank, and a photo booth courtesy of McNeese Title. Attendees also had the opportunity to view and bid on various pieces of art, jewelry, gift baskets, trips, and other luxurious items featured throughout the extensive silent auction.

Sponsors and VIP attendees also received exclusive access to a pre-party event sponsored by A Boheme Design.
